Is Bangladesh warmer or hotter than Lincoln Park, Illinois?

On average across the year, yes, Bangladesh is hotter than Lincoln Park, Illinois . Bangladesh has an average temperature of 26°C/79°F and Lincoln Park, Illinois has an average temperature of 11°C/52°F.

Bangladesh's hottest month is May, with an average maximum temperature of 34°C/93°F, which is hotter than Lincoln Park, Illinois's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F).

Is Bangladesh colder or cooler than Lincoln Park, Illinois?

On average across the year, no, Bangladesh is not colder than Lincoln Park, Illinois . Bangladesh has an average minimum temperature of 21°C/70°F and Lincoln Park, Illinois has an average minimum temperature of 7°C/45°F.



Bangladesh's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of 12°C/54°F, which is not colder than Lincoln Park, Illinois's coldest month (also January, with an average minimum temperature of -7°C/19°F).

Does Bangladesh have more rain than Lincoln Park, Illinois?

On average across the year, yes, Bangladesh has more rain than Lincoln Park, Illinois. Bangladesh has an average annual rainfall of 1402mm and Lincoln Park, Illinois has an average annual rainfall of 1222mm.

Bangladesh's wettest month is July, with an average monthly rainfall of 291mm, which is wetter than Lincoln Park, Illinois's wettest month (May, with an average monthly rainfall of 162mm).
